Bella

Picture
STATS
Age: 8 years
Breed: Lurcher
Likes: People, slow paced walks, lots of cuddles
​Dislikes: Being left for long periods of time

This is our beautiful lurcher girl, Bella. This lovely lady is a real sweetheart, and is gentle and loving with everyone she meets, especially if they give her lots of fuss and cuddles. As Bella is getting to be a bit of an older lady she will not need long walks but short little strolls around the countryside.

As you would expect from her breed, Bella is likely to chase small furries, so would be better living in a home with no cats,but has lived with a calm dog and has had no problems. 
Bella's perfect home would be with someone who is home a lot, as she does get anxious when she is left alone. However, when this lovely girl has human companionship she is a relaxed and happy lady who is ready for her forever home.
